New treatments,such as sipuleucel-t and androgen receptor-(ar-) directed therapies (enzalutamide (enz) and abiraterone acetate (aa)),have emerged and been approved for the management of castration-resistant prostate cancer (crpc). there are still debates over their efficacy and clinical benefits. this meta-analysis aimed to investigate the efficacy and safety of sipuleucel-t and ar-directed therapies in patients with crpc. revman 5.1 was used for pooled analysis and analysis of publication bias. seven studies were included in the meta-analysis,with three studies in sipuleucel-t (totally 737 patients,488 patients in treatment group,and 249 patients in placebo group) and four in ar-directed therapies (totally 5,199 patients,3,015 patients in treatment group,and 2,184 patients in placebo group). treatment with sipuleucel-t significantly improved overall survival in patients with crpc and was not associated with increased risk of adverse event of grade ≥3 (p>0.05). however,treatment with sipuleucel-t did not improve time-to-progression and reduction of prostate-specific antigen (psa) level ≥50% was not significantly different from that with placebo. ar-directed therapies significantly improved overall survival in patients with crpc and improved time-to-progression and reduction of psa level ≥50%. ar-directed therapies did not increase risk of adverse event of grade ≥3 (p>0.05). © 2016 renliang yi et al.
